I have a 87 cressida with 201,000 miles on it . Starting in cold weather is tough. The problem is that when i go to drive i can floor the gas peddle and wont build any more then 1800 rpm, and about 20 mph. as soon as it shifts into third gear it seems to do fine until i get to the next stop light. I have yota friends but they are just as stumped as i am.

Answer
Service and maintenance could be a factor also the catalytic converter could be worn out.With the high mileage,possibly loss of compression.If the engine has good enough compression,i would then look at the drive train,that is the transmission first gear.
